In this review of Debates in Art and Design Education, the bottom line is simple: this is a thoughtful, classroom-focused book for student and practising art teachers who want a critical, theory-informed approach to teaching art. The fully updated second edition gathers contributors from practice and academia to present clear arguments about policy, skills and visual culture, and the reviewer found it useful for grounding classroom choices in theory. It reads as a compact, readable resource that encourages reflective teaching rather than offering lesson-by-lesson prescriptions.

Who It's For

Debates in Art and Design Education is aimed primarily at trainee art teachers, early-career practitioners and lecturers who need a concise, theory-informed resource to support reflective practice. It suits readers who want to understand the debates shaping secondary art education rather than a collection of classroom projects.

Those looking for step-by-step lesson plans, a handbook of practical techniques, or a richly illustrated art workbook should look elsewhere; this book is focused on concepts, policy discussion and the rationale behind pedagogic choices rather than being a technique manual.
